javascript - PapaParse 不起作用(返回空数组)

标签 javascript csv papaparse

我正在尝试解析此文件的变体(我没有使用制表符作为分隔符,而是使用以逗号作为分隔符的文件)https://github.com/materechm/Schizophrenia/blob/master/GWAS.txt

这是我的代码,但我得到一个空数组并且没有错误

        var csv = Papa.parse('GWAS.csv', {
        delimiter: ",",
        header: true,
        comments: false,
        complete: function(results) {
        console.log(results);
        }
        });

最佳答案

没有数据,因为您启用了标题行,因此输入的第一行是标题行(在 meta 属性中查找标题行中找到的字段列表)。

您只提供了一行输入,即字符串“GWAS.csv”,因此没有数据。

如果您打算解析文件,则需要 pass in a File object from the DOMspecify download: true in the config让 Papa Parse 将输入字符串解释为从中下载输入文件的 URL。

关于javascript - PapaParse 不起作用(返回空数组),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26539431/

相关文章:

javascript - 从 Django 服务器读取 > 1 GB CSV 文件并在模板中显示

javascript - 处理 papaparse 时更改 CSV header

Python - 比较两个 csv 文件中的重复值并将该行写入单独的 csv 文件中

php - 搜索 csv 列并插入到 mysql

javascript - 图像转换错误裁剪

javascript - 如何使用javascript在嵌套构建表中使用数组

csv - 从 CSV 文件中过滤掉小于阈值的值

javascript - 使用 jQuery 加载脚本后无法使用 javascript 函数

javascript - 无法读取未定义的属性,运行时错误

javascript - 使用 Dimple.js 渲染图表时出现问题